Kawasaki City will host "Ekimae Yuen Park" on Sunday, May 31, 2026, at the Mukogaoka-Yuen Station South Exit Square. A portion of the roadway will be temporary pedestrian-only space where visitors can enjoy picnics, various crafts, and rickshaw rides while experiencing the fresh greenery. Following the event held last autumn, this social experiment aims to explore the utilization of public spaces. The event is organized through industry-government-academia collaboration, with support from Nippon Steel Kowa Real Estate Co., Ltd. (headquartered in Minato-ku, Tokyo) and Odakyu Real Estate Co., Ltd. (headquartered in Shibuya-ku, Tokyo), as well as a talk event involving students from Senshu University located in Tama-ku, Kawasaki City. To create attractive hubs utilizing the natural environment of Ikuta Ryokuchi and local cultural facilities around Noborito and Mukogaoka-Yuen Stations, the city is conducting social experiments to establish comfortable, walkable spaces filled with nature, wood, and greenery. Event Details: Date & Time: Sunday, May 31, 2026, from 10:00 AM to 3:00 PM (In case of rain, the talk events will be held inside Chuwa Building, while other outdoor events will be canceled). Location: Mukogaoka-Yuen Station South Exit Square (2737 Noborito, Tama-ku, and surrounding areas). Organizer: Kawasaki City. Co-organizers: Nippon Steel Kowa Real Estate Co., Ltd., Odakyu Real Estate Co., Ltd. Event Programs: Artificial Grass Picnic Area (with food trucks), Play with Wooden Blocks (made from domestic lumber), Beyblade on the Grass (morning tournament is pre-registered, with some paid craft activities), Rickshaw rides (paid), and Craft Workshops hosted by popular local artists (e.g., calendar keychains and tiles, materials fees apply, morning registration starts at 10:00 AM, afternoon registration at 12:00 PM). Talk Events (No reservation required, free of charge): 10:30 AM - 12:00 PM: "What Art Can Do for Town Development" with Nobuko Shimuta (Editor/Design Researcher), Tomoharu Matsuda (Planner/Poet), and Meiji Hijikata (Director of Taro Okamoto Museum of Art, Kawasaki); 12:00 PM - 12:15 PM: "Connecting People and Towns Through Beer Brewing" by students of the GDX Lab, School of Network and Information Studies, Senshu University; 1:00 PM - 2:30 PM: Talk on comfortable plaza spaces by Yuko Yamashita (Plaza Specialist). An open house public briefing regarding the draft "Mukogaoka-Yuen Station South Side Town Development Policy" will also be held concurrently.
